xref: /csrg-svn/sys/netccitt/x25err.h (revision 63216)
141711Ssklower /*
241711Ssklower  * Copyright (c) University of British Columbia, 1984
3*63216Sbostic  * Copyright (c) 1990, 1993
4*63216Sbostic  *	The Regents of the University of California.  All rights reserved.
541711Ssklower  *
641711Ssklower  * This code is derived from software contributed to Berkeley by
741711Ssklower  * the Laboratory for Computation Vision and the Computer Science Department
841711Ssklower  * of the University of British Columbia.
941711Ssklower  *
1041711Ssklower  * %sccs.include.redist.c%
1141711Ssklower  *
12*63216Sbostic  *	@(#)x25err.h	8.1 (Berkeley) 06/10/93
1341711Ssklower  */
1441711Ssklower 
1541597Ssklower /*
1641597Ssklower  *
1741597Ssklower  *  X.25 Reset and Clear errors and diagnostics.  These values are
1841597Ssklower  *  returned in the u_error field of the u structure.
1941597Ssklower  *
2041597Ssklower  */
2141597Ssklower 
2241597Ssklower #define EXRESET		100	/* Reset: call reset			*/
2341597Ssklower #define EXROUT		101	/* Reset: out of order			*/
2441597Ssklower #define EXRRPE		102	/* Reset: remote procedure error	*/
2541597Ssklower #define EXRLPE		103	/* Reset: local procedure error		*/
2641597Ssklower #define EXRNCG		104	/* Reset: network congestion		*/
2741597Ssklower 
2841597Ssklower #define EXCLEAR		110	/* Clear: call cleared			*/
2941597Ssklower #define EXCBUSY 	111	/* Clear: number busy			*/
3041597Ssklower #define EXCOUT		112	/* Clear: out of order			*/
3141597Ssklower #define EXCRPE		113	/* Clear: remote procedure error	*/
3241597Ssklower #define EXCRRC		114	/* Clear: collect call refused		*/
3341597Ssklower #define EXCINV		115	/* Clear: invalid call			*/
3441597Ssklower #define EXCAB		116	/* Clear: access barred			*/
3541597Ssklower #define EXCLPE		117	/* Clear: local procedure error		*/
3641597Ssklower #define EXCNCG		118	/* Clear: network congestion		*/
3741597Ssklower #define EXCNOB		119	/* Clear: not obtainable		*/
3841597Ssklower 
39